About
Partner at Kyriakides Georgopoulos Law Firm specializing in EU law, competition and antitrust, regulatory and compliance, the digital economy and consumer protection. Previously served at the Directorate General of Competition and, since 2012, as Commissioner–Rapporteur of the Hellenic Competition Commission, with experience in cartels, abuse of dominance, merger control, state aid, leniency, commitments and investigations.
